Stateful queries carry an organization boundary. Server-side authorization protects decisions, policies, approvals, exports, connections, and administration.
Sessions are hashed, HTTP-only, SameSite, expiring, and revocable. Google OAuth tokens are verified against issuer signing keys.
OIDC supports Authorization Code with PKCE and JWKS validation. SAML 2.0 validates signed assertions and audience/domain binding. Both support forced SSO and role mapping; SCIM supports revocable provisioning.
Published policy versions and authorization decisions keep the actor, target, result, reason, and timestamp required for review.
Stripe webhooks are signature-verified and replay-protected. Composio holds provider authorization while Endram stores workspace-scoped connection identifiers.
SQLite runs in WAL mode with integrity checks. Backups support independent encryption, off-box storage, and restore verification.
The deployment supports a non-root container behind TLS, read-only filesystems, dropped capabilities, health checks, and resource limits.
Endram does not claim independent certification without current evidence. Implemented controls and current boundaries are stated directly.
